Online lead generation challenges faced by small businesses
1. Online Lead Generation Challenges Faced
by Small Businesses
The field of Internet Marketing has grown to be a professional arena for all types of businesses, including
the ones that are solely making money online. Furthermore, it is not only corporate giants who benefit
from online marketing and promotions. In fact, you would find countless success stories of small
businesses all over the world that are exploiting their maximum performance potential because of their
online presence.
With a plethora of benefits and business implications, Internet Marketing is a great source of lead
generation. Basically, online lead generation is an identical concept of generating sales lead except that
the process is done on electronic platforms. In layman’s terms, “offline” lead generation involves
traditional methods like cold calling, customer referrals, TV and radio advertisements, etc. On the other
hand, there are various Internet Marketing tools which provide access to small businesses to their
individuals who are interested in what the companies offer. These individuals are considered to be
prospective buyers for a business. Some of the common techniques of online lead generation include:
Social Media Marketing
Article or Content Marketing
Search Engine Optimization (SEO)
Pay Per Click (PPC) Advertising
Online Video Marketing
Blogs, EBooks, Newsletters
Despite the ability of online advertising to generate leads, there are several small businesses which find it
difficult to acquire its wonderful benefits in its true sense. Generally, online lead generation challenges
refer to inefficient generation of potential contacts or customers. Keeping focus of discussion on small
businesses, a few common online lead generation challenges are explained below in the following section.
2. Key Online Lead Generation Challenges for Small
Businesses
Most online lead generation challenges are specific to the methods integrated in an online marketing
campaign which aim at attracting prospective readers and customers. However, there are several online
lead generation challenges which are generic in nature and commonly faced by small businesses.
1. The Myopic Content-Target Mismatch
This is one of the online lead generation challenges faced by small business owners when they miss the
bull’s eye. This means that the lead generation methods which they use do not cover areas or content
which are preferred by the target audience. On the other hand, these business owners develop techniques
which they deem appropriate or attractive for the target readers. In short, this is one of the online lead
generation challenges which are a result of an entrepreneurial miscalculation.
In order to generate productive leads, small business owners must synergize their offering with the needs
and wants of the target audience. This is only possible when you would stop imposing your ideas of
appealing content on the readers. Secondly, small businesses should exploit all possible resources to
gather insight on what their prospective customers are interested in.

2. The Quantity & Quality Dilemma
When we speak of small businesses, it is important to consider the fewer number and types of resources
available to them. As a result, their marketing and promotion budgets are also limited in nature. However,
these facts are not the main online lead generation challenges for small business owners. The complex
issue is that of budget allocation on either quality or quantity of content. In addition to the content used
for lead generation, quality and quantity of the leads themselves is also a part of the online lead
generation challenges. Every small business, rightfully enough, aims at sufficient and large number of
leads. However, there are many instances when small businesses allow this aim to overshadow the
importance of and focus on quality of leads. This way, small businesses become unable to convert
generated leads into sales.
3. Follow Up Framework: The Small Business Weak Point
Among other complexities, following up on prospects seems to be one of the continuous online lead
generation challenges. As discussed earlier, issues with allocation of budget and resources can make it
daunting for small business owners to incorporate a systematic follow up system. However, the absence or
inefficiency of a follow up arrangement for online leads can be a costly blunder. While many small
business owners may argue that they always follow up on their leads, it is often overlooked that the
process should be as swift as under the span of 24 hours. For example, it is usually required to set up
automated systems for phone call returns, email auto-responders, etc. Although it is challenging and
costly to establish and implement a mechanism for speedy follow up on leads, it is an essential
requirement for the process of converting leads into sales.
4. Effective but Heavy on the Pocket
There are some successful lead generation techniques, like Pay Per Click Advertising (PPC), which are
becoming increasingly expensive for small businesses to afford. Incidentally, PPC is an effective
4. advertising tool to drive traffic to a website but then an amount is to be paid every time the advertisement
is clicked on. Apart from the expenses incurred through this form of advertising, it also brings another
type of online lead generation challenges in the picture. Basically, if a small business invests an ample
amount in PPC then it must also invest further on the quality of what it has to offer. If this is not done,
then the business would find a low or insufficient conversion rate in the generated leads.
5. Surviving Against Competition
Competitor practices also impose online lead generation challenges for many small businesses. One of the
reasons why this is among the list of main online lead generation challenges is the better financial
resources of some direct competitors. Secondly, technological inclination of competitors along with their
available resources further adds to the pressure faced by small businesses.
The objective is not to feel perplexed that on one hand, Internet Marketing is a beneficial tool for
attracting potential customers while it also involves a variety of online lead generation challenges for
small businesses. In fact, small business owners should understand the possible online lead generation
challenges so they are able to create a balanced approach towards their online advertising techniques,
response mechanism, track of conversion, and so on. The key to overcome online lead generation
challenges is to hit the spot with a balanced budget allocation as well as a balanced ratio between quality
and quantity of content and leads alike.
